Enrique Iglesias and Pitbull Announce Joint Tour With CNCO Opening
Enrique Iglesias and Pitbull will tour together with CNCO as their supporting act this summer.
Enrique Iglesias and Pitbull will once again hit the road together. The pair kick off their co-headlining summer North American tour June 3 in Chicago’s AllState Arena, playing a total of 16 cities and ending in Toronto’s Air Canada Center July 6.
The opening act for the tour will be boy band CNCO, the increasingly popular group spawned from Univision reality show La Banda. Last time Iglesias and Pitbull toured together, in 2015, J Balvin was the supporting act, an auspicious precedent for CNCO.
The tour is presented by Live Nation with tickets on sale March 24.
Pitbull and Iglesias last toured together in 2015, as part of their successful North American jaunt which got extended from 2014 to 2015.
